POSITION R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Greet all visitors that come to the office and notify appropriate staff of their arrival as applicable.
  • Manage and maintain the waiting room area, including cleanliness and sanitation.
  • Open and close the front office as needed.
  • Manage the consumer arrival and departure process by check- in, schedule and reschedule appointments.
  • Input and update consumer charts as needed or requested.
  • Update insurance information by sending an email to Insurance Verification Team.
  • Obtain paperwork for clients without insurance for sliding scale fee.
  • Request and obtain payments for services.
  • Performs filing, photocopying, general document creation, type letters, memos, and reports as needed.
  • Meets agency Key Performance Indicators.
  • Answer and route incoming phone calls.
  • Receive and distribute interoffice mail, incoming faxes, postal mail, and deliveries.
  • Monitor building cameras for unusual activity and report to supervisor as applicable.
  • Monitors incoming faxes daily and forwards/scans appropriately.
  • Completes registration and required paperwork for new consumers during same day access.
  • Obtain Release of Information (ROIs) paperwork yearly and as needed for clients.
  • Review and complete site specific reports on a regular scheduled basis.
  • Schedule all telehealth services and send links requesting telehealth payments to clients
  • Files and scans consumer documents into the EMR
  • Completes daily scheduled audits (check in/no shows)
  • Enter new clients & program participation into appropriate Electronic Medical Records Databases.
  • Manages client transportation needs including Medicaid Answering Services (MAS) system as applicable.
  • Prepare letters to request medical records and client authorizations and maintain a log of requests and record received per HIPAA compliance regulations.
  • Sends Primary Care Physician (PCP) & other providers correspondence letters as well as outreach letters to current clients.
  • Assigns, removes, and updates client encounters in EMR as needed.
  • Maintains client confidentiality at all times following all agency and HIPPA policies.
  • Completes all trainings required by the agency.
  • Performs all other duties as assigned.
